The follow note is stored against William W Wescombe record:

William Waldren Wescombe was the son of George and Francies[sic] Wescombe, and the second of nine children. He was born in Guestling, Sussex, on 23rd April 1894 according to his birth certificate, though his naval record says 1893. He joined the Navy on 21st September 1911, and at the time of his death was a Stoker 1st Class on H.M.S. Penelope. He died from diphtheria in the Royal Naval Hospital at Shotley on 31st December 1915, and is also remembered on the War Memorial in Crowborough, (East) Sussex, his parents' place of residence at the time of his death.
